Isistimu yebhethri ye-lithium-ion esezingeni eliphezulu isebenzisa amaseli ebhethri e-lithium iron phosphate (LiFePO₄) aphephile, afaka ukufakwa kalula, umklamo ohlangene futhi osesitayeleni ohlanganisa ngaphandle komthungo ezindaweni zokuhlala nezokuhwebelana, kanye nokuhambisana nama-inverter ajwayelekile ayi-hybrid, ahlinzeka ngezixazululo ezifanele zezinhlelo zokusebenza ezahlukene zokulondoloza amandla.
| Imodeli yomkhiqizo | HJ-HBL48303F( B-31) |
| Into | Ipharamitha |
| Isilinganiso se-Voltage | 51.2V |
| Umthamo | 300Ah |
| umthamo omncane | .300Ah |
| imodi yokuxhumana | RS232,CAN,RS485 |
| Ukushaja Voltage | 58.4V |
| Shaja yamanje | ≤200A |
| Impedance | ≤30mΩ(Ubukhulu) |
| Imodi yokushaja | CC / CV |
| Indlela yokushaja | Ukushaja Okujwayelekile 0.2C Ukushaja Ngokushesha0.5C |
| Ukushaja Isikhathi | Mayelana namahora angu-6 |
| Mayelana namahora angu-3 | |
| I-Overcharge Voltage | 3.65V/ Iseli |
| I-Over Discharge Sika I-Voltage | 2.8V/ Iseli |
| Kulinganiswe ngo ukukhishwa kwamanje | ≤200A |
| Ngaphezulu Kwamanje | 220A |
| Isikhathi esifushane | Phinda uthole ngemva kokukhipha umthwalo wesekethe emfushane |
| I-Operating ConsumptionCurrent | 50mA(Ubukhulu) |
| Operating Temperature | +10~+45℃。-20~+60℃ |
| Isitoreji Temperature | -20℃-50℃Ncoma (25±5℃) |
| I-Cycle Life | Umjikelezo ka-6000 |
| Ubukhulu (mm) | 830 * 500 * 250mm |
| Isisindo (KG) | ≥ 144.6kg |
| Inkokhelo yomkhiqizo othunyelwe | 50% -60% ukulethwa kwevolumu yebhethri |
| Izinto zephakheji | Ikhathoni + ithreyi lokufutha lezinkuni |

Isebenzisa amaseli ebhethri e-lithium iron phosphate, uhlelo luphephile futhi luthembekile, lunempilo yomjikelezo engaphezu kwemijikelezo engu-6,500 (DoD 80%), ehlangabezana nezidingo zokusetshenziswa kwesikhathi eside. Amaseli ebhethri athobelana nezindinganiso eziqinile zokuphepha futhi afaka ukuqina kokushisa nokumelana nezinga lokushisa eliphezulu.
Iseli yebhethri ngayinye ifakwe i-BMS ezimele, esekela ukuqapha nokuvikela kwesikhathi sangempela (ukushajwa ngokweqile, ukushajwa ngokweqile, ukushisa ngokweqile, i-overcurrent, njll.), kanye nokuzuza ukulinganisa kwamandla kagesi phakathi kwamaseli ebhethri ngamanye ukuze kuthuthukiswe ukuqina kohlelo lonke.
Idizayini ye-plug-and-play iqeda isidingo sezintambo eziyinkimbinkimbi, kunciphisa kakhulu isikhathi sokufaka nezindleko zomsebenzi. Idizayini yobuhle bezimboni ehlangene nesitayela ilinganisela ukusetshenziswa kwendawo nokukhanga okubonakalayo, kulungele izimo ezihlukene zokuhlala noma ezohwebo.
Ihlanganisa ngaphandle komthungo nemikhiqizo eminingi ye-hybrid inverter emakethe, ithuthukisa ukuguquguquka kwesistimu yokuhlanganisa.
